‘MacVoices’ looks at running Windows on a Mac

Posted by Dennis Sellers Apple ico Dec 14, 2007 at 5:50am

imageOn the new , MacVoices, Joe Kissell talks about the update to his Take Control of Running Windows on Mac.

He updates listeners on the latest developments on running Windows on Macs. Kissell starts with the latest on Boot Camp now that Mac OS X 10.5 (“Leopard”) has shipped and what happens if you aren’t ready to upgrade your operating system.

Parallels and VMWare Fusion have also seen updates and Kissell talks about what’s new in the virtualization-option arena, running Vista on the Mac. He also answers the question: “What is your best option for running Windows on the Mac?”

MacVoices is an Internet show and podcast that delivers in-depth discussions with the most influential people in the Mac industry, as well as “the individuals who are out there making it happen on the front lines of the global Apple community,” according to host Chuck Joiner.
